SBC Abuse Survivors Issue Joint Statement Urging 4 Reforms That ‘Need Immediate Action’

In the statement’s final section, “Subsequent Work,” the survivors say, “In addition (but not as a substitute for immediate actions), we support the creation of an independent Abuse Reform Implementation Task Force” to devise a strategic plan and timeline for implementation of other Guidepost and SATF recommendations within the next three years.”

A list of “challenges and formal recommendations” from the Sexual Abuse Task Force is lengthier than the survivors’ statement and also includes the creation of an Abuse Reform Implementation Task Force, financial compensation for survivors, and the creation of a “Ministry Check” website. The report from Guidepost Solutions contains recommended action steps as well. 

When asked on Twitter if and how the survivors’ recommendations differ from those of the SATF, Woodson replied, “These are reforms we feel need immediate action, as to support ALL SBC clergy abuse survivors, by providing a permanent, independent, safe place to report abuse and that will conduct inquiries, a database and restitution.”
